Brainlest for who correct In the system of sharecropping in the late 1800s,
O farmers rented land from landowners in return for a share of the crops.
O farmers bought land from landowners in return for shares of crops.
farmers and landowners shared ownership of land and profits equally.
farmers worked for landowners in exchange for fair wages.

Answers

Farmer rented land from landowners in return for a share of the crops

Under the system of sharecropping Black farmers rented land from White landowners who took an unfair percentage of crops from the Black farmers. These landowners even made their farmers pay for seeds and tools by subtracting those costs from the proceeds from their crops. The result is called debt peonage, which prevented sharecroppers from leaving the land until they paid what they owed the landowners, making them effectively enslaved.

How are the number of House seats calculated?

Answers

Answer:

Apportionments.

Explanation:

Under Article I, Section 2 of the Constitution, seats in the House of Representatives are apportioned among the states by population, as determined by the census conducted every ten years. Each state is entitled to at least one representative, however small its population.

HEY CAN ANYONE WRITE A PARAGRAPH EXPLAINING ABOUT ANCIENT SPORTS!

Answers

Answer:

People have played sports seemingly since the dawn of time when the first cities and organized civilisations emerged. Unsurprisingly, ancient Egyptians enjoyed both individual and team sports. Just as ancient Greece had its Olympic Games ancient Egyptians enjoyed playing many of the same activities.

Egyptian tombs contain numerous paintings showing Egyptians playing sports. This documentary evidence help Egyptologists understand how sports were played and athletes performed. Written accounts of games and especially royal hunts have also come down to us.

Many tomb paintings depict archers aiming at targets rather than animals during a hunt, so Egyptologists are confident know archery was also a sport. Paintings showing gymnastics also support it as a common sport. These inscriptions depict ancient Egyptians demonstrating specific tumbling and using other people as hurdles and vaulting horses. Similarly, hockey, handball and rowing all appear amongst the wall art in ancient Egyptian tomb paintings.
